It was a beautiful day to be out, but not so great for taking photos because of a constant breeze. I was hoping to find some colorful butterflies, but other than a few impossible skippers, the butterfly of the day was the cabbage white. They were everywhere, thick as thieves! The red clover and thistle seemed to be a favorite at one park, whereas the herb garden, and specifically the lavender patch, was the hot spot at the botanical park. I\u2019d forgotten how well these butterflies like lavender since I don\u2019t have it growing in my own garden any longer.<\/p>\n<p>Anyway, while checking the pond edge for dragonflies, I came across this group of cabbage whites puddling along a damp place in the path. I\u2019ve seen photos of swallowtails doing this \u2013 <a href=\"http:\/\/brownstonebirder.blogspot.com\/\">Larry<\/a> has posted a few on his blog \u2013 but I\u2019d never seen it for myself.
